Use a soft, dry cloth for cleaning.
For stubborn dirt, soak the cloth in a weak detergent solution,
wring the cloth wall, and wipe the unit. Usa a dry cloth to
wipe it dry.
Do not use any type of solvent, such as thinner and benzine,
as they may damage the surface of the DVD video player.
Ifyou use a chemical saturated cloth to clean the unit, follow
that product's instructions.

The DVD video player is a high technology, precision device, ff
the optical pick-up lens and disc drive parts are dirty or worn
down, the picture quality beoomes poor.To obtain a dear
picture, we recommend regular inspection and maintenance
(cleaning or parts replacement) every 1,000 hours of use
depending on the operating environment. For details, contact
your nearest dealer.
